On December 24, 2021 at 13:43 UTC, a magnitude 5.7 shallow crustal earthquake struck 88 km NNW of Phôngsali, Laos, at a depth of 9.5 km and coordinates 22.3699°, 101.6708°. The earthquake was reported felt by 12 peopleacross nearby locations, with a maximum shaking intensity of Modified Mercalli Intensity (MMI) 6.9 (very strong). The USGS PAGER system issued a yellow alert level for this event, indicating local impact possible. The nearest populated place is Menglie (population 0).

Physical scale: An earthquake of magnitude 5.7 releases seismic energy equivalent to roughly 5 kilotons of TNT. Empirical fault-scaling laws (Wells & Coppersmith, 1994) estimate the subsurface rupture length at approximately 5.2 km — a useful intuition for the size of the slip patch on the fault.
